FAI after SCFE screw removal and osteoplasty - Hip arthroscopy

by Benjamin Domb, M.D. | 15 years ago

Hip arthroscopy for Femoral Acetabular Impingement (FAI) for a 21 year old patient 10 years after surgery for Slipped Capital Femoral Epiphisis (SCFE). The SCFE resulted in a large cam lesion and labral tear, or tear of the labrum.
